There are also 18 secret trophies, giving a total of 36 trophies. From what I can gather, 16 of these secret trophies are story-related, with one of the remaining two being the platinum, and the other looks like a gold for maybe doing something similar to getting the Muse Keys in God of War I.
That’s an educated guess. Among those 16 secret trophies, 10 are bronze, while 6 are silver. That’s not a guess, I’m just using some simple Maths there. Anyways, good luck getting that platinum…
